Executive Assistant
Apply NowTitle: Executive Assistant
Company Description: NYC-Based Culinary Business
Location: New York, NY
Responsibilities:
Executive Support:
- Manage the executive's calendar, schedule meetings, and coordinate travel arrangements.
- Organize and prioritize incoming requests, emails, and phone calls; respond on behalf of the executive when necessary.
- Prepare and edit correspondence, presentations, and other documents as needed.
- Handle sensitive and confidential information with professionalism and discretion.
Project Management:
- Assist in tracking progress of key projects, deadlines, and deliverables for the executive.
- Prepare reports, summaries, and presentations for internal and external stakeholders.
- Coordinate with other departments and teams to ensure alignment on initiatives.
Communication & Liaison:
- Serve as the primary point of contact between the executive and internal/external stakeholders.
- Facilitate communication and manage relationships with clients, partners, and other important contacts.
- Coordinate logistics for board meetings, executive retreats, or other corporate events.
Administrative Support:
- Organize and maintain filing systems, both physical and electronic.
- Handle expense reports and manage budgets as assigned.
- Assist in the preparation of reports, agendas, and meeting materials for various internal and external meetings.
Operational Efficiency:
- Identify opportunities for improving processes and workflows to enhance executive efficiency.
- Ensure that all tasks are completed with a high level of attention to detail and within deadlines.
